# Logistics Transition: Brinmark → Oskette Freight

*Restricted: Managers only*

Welcome aboard! Quick background: we switched our primary logistics provider from Brinmark Haulage to Oskette Freight last fall. Brinmark's rates kept climbing and their cold-chain coverage never reached the Fennley corridor. Oskette has been solid so far — fewer missed windows, better tracking, and friendlier account support. A few legacy Brinmark lanes still run through year-end. The confidential planning context sits below for your reference.

confidential, tahop-hahap: The board signed off on a budget of $192.1 million for Project Zordor.

Tuned relevance scoring for the Seekline query pipeline. Field boosts for title and tag matches were rebalanced, and the stale-document decay curve was steepened to reduce surfacing of archived records. From a security standpoint: no changes to access filtering; permission checks still run before ranking, and the tuning parameters are read from the signed config bundle only. All adjustments were replayed against the sanitized evaluation corpus. The final review and parameter sign-off came from the engineer listed below.

named custodian: Brivan Eliath Quenox Frador

**Q: Can my plugin control when batch digests are sent?**

Partially. MailWeave plugins may propose a preferred send window via the `digest_hint` field, but the core scheduler makes the final decision based on tenant quiet hours and queue load. Hints outside a tenant's allowed window are silently clamped, never rejected. Plugins must therefore treat delivery times as advisory. The complete scheduling precedence rules are documented here.

dashboard of yafog-fajof = https://jira.tolvaqsys.internal/pages/pages/projects/49fe21c4